The decision as to the acceptance of a company into EPSC membership rests with the Management Board.
EPSC membership / fee payment runs per calendar year (January 1 - December 31). The membership will become effective upon receipt of the first membership fee payment. After this, the membership will automatically renew at the end of the year for another 12 months.
Full members are in most cases manufacturing companies (asset owners).
Annual fee (excl. VAT) is based on global turnover of the organisation:
€2,000 for turnover up to €300M
€4,000 for turnover up to €600M
€6,000 for turnover up to €900M
€8,000 for turnover up to €1200M
€9,500 for turnover €1500M and above
Associates are generally non manufacturing companies or other organisations (solution providers). They receive the same information as full members, including:
Associates’ representatives do not attend the General Meetings (Technical Meetings) nor participate in EPSC Working Groups or Contact Groups unless specifically invited.
The annual fee (excl. VAT) for associates is €1,000.
Membership cancellation for the following year must be in writing and is possible until 30 September (three months notice until the end of the year).
